Vijay Amritraj calls on Union Sports Minister Vijay Goel

| | Apr 12, 2017, at 01:35 am
New Delhi, Apr 11 (IBNS): Former Indian tennis player Vijay Amritraj here today called on the Union Minister of State (I/C) for Youth Affairs and Sports Vijay Goel.

During their meeting, Amritraj expressed his desire to boost tennis in India and also help the government to work together in promotion of sports and talent search.

Vijay Goel stated that his Ministry will initiate scholarships for talented tennis players and will provide them the best facilities so that India can win big in the global arena.

Later answering questions by media persons on the recent Mahesh Bhupathi-Leander Paes controversy, the Minister said that the prerogative to select the playing squad is of the captain but if there's any major conflict, the Ministry would surely help in the mediation process in the larger interest of sports.

He reiterated that the doors of his Ministry are open 24x7 for players, coaches and other officials and they are free to share their problems and issues of concern. He said, the Ministry will surely work for making situation better and resolving the issues.

Later, IOA President N. Ramachandran also called on the Union Sports Minister Vijay Goel to invite him for the Asian Squash Championship which Minister accepted.

Vijay Goel welcomed the IOA's decision to recognise the Boxing Federation of India which will be a big boon for players and their future.
